A diagnostic imaging technologist is a professional who follows the instructions of a doctor, he uses radiation: X-ray or electromagnetism: MRI to produce images of the body of patients, or to treat them depending on the patient’s health condition.
The medical imaging technologist performs X-rays from a medical prescription given by the patient’s doctor. Depending on the prescription the examination will be done by an angiography, ultrasound, or magnetic resonance imaging (MRI), these examinations will be used to produce images of the anatomy and provide information about the functioning of certain parts of the body.

Generally, the medical imaging technologist works in the public sector which includes hospitals as well as clinics. There are many benefits to working in the health field such as paid leave, pension, and job security. There are bonuses for working at night.
To become a medical imaging technologist, you will need to enroll at a college that offers the Diagnostic Imaging Technology program. This program will require Secondary IV culture, society, and technology and Secondary IV environmental science and technology or science and environment.
Initially, you will start at $23.75 which is the minimum wage, but with time and experience that you will acquire. You will be able to reach an amount ranging from $39 which was the maximum amount in the year 2022, but nowadays you can earn more.
Upon graduation, an entry-to-practice examination will be required from the College of Medical Imaging, Radiation Oncology and Electrophysiology Technologists (OTIMROEPMQ) and the Canadian Association of Medical Radiation Technologists ( CAMRT).
Several factors could put us at risk. Such as machine radiation, biological agents, patients, and also ergonomics at work.
